I spent a lot of time in Blackburrow leveling alts over the years. Since the last patch nerfed the experience of the gnoll fangs, I thought it'd be interesting to determine just how much it was nerfed.
Before nerf: 20k exp per fang
After nerf: 8k exp per fang
It's still not bad but was nerfed 60% so it is pretty much a ghost town now.
In case you were curious how many fangs you would get if you PB AOE'd the entire zone at once, it averages 30 fangs.
Blackburrow has a 24 minute respawn rate I believe. Rounding up all the gnolls (make sure the zone is empty) could take 6 minutes so you're looking at two full pulls an hour.
60 fangs x 8000 exp = 480,000 experience an hour. (This would take you from level 1 to almost level 9 as a Dwarf Cleric for example)
If you were broke and needed to PL your own toon, this would be an okay way to do it if you do it late when no one else is in the zone but not a super efficient method. Especially when you consider you have to run to Qeynos and turn them all in which burns a lot of time. You'll also be a fizzle/whiff king/queen.
